What Is AI Verification?

AI verification is not performed by artificial intelligence. It is the documented process of supporting identity, authority, provenance, public claims, and source relationships so people and independent AI systems can evaluate information more responsibly.

Verification strengthens public information—not AI opinions.

Independent AI systems continue making their own retrieval, interpretation, and ranking decisions. Verification improves the quality, continuity, and supporting evidence surrounding public information.

CLEAR DEFINITION

AI verification supports public understanding.

AI verification is the documented process of confirming, organizing, and maintaining public information surrounding a defined subject such as a municipality, business, institution, official, service, location, publication, or public record.

Its purpose is to strengthen the quality of publicly available information through identifiable sources, authority relationships, evidence, provenance, continuity, governance, and documented corrections.

Verification does not determine what an AI system will ultimately say. Instead, it strengthens the public information environment from which independent systems retrieve, compare, interpret, and resolve information.

COMMON MISCONCEPTIONS

AI verification does not mean...

❌ Artificial intelligence approved something.
❌ Google or another AI platform certified a business.
❌ ChatGPT guarantees accuracy.
❌ Rankings or citations are guaranteed.
